Suppose the number is x. The sum of the number and two is x+2 Four times the sum is 4(x+2) The number times 8 is 8x 24 less than the number times 8 is 8x-24 4(x+2) = 8x-24 4x+8=8x-24 so 4x = 32 and x = 8

To express "32 is the sum of a number z and 9" as an equation, you can write it as: ( z + 9 = 32 ). This equation states that when you add the number ( z ) to 9, the result equals 32. You can also rearrange it to solve for ( z ) by subtracting 9 from both sides, resulting in ( z = 32 - 9 ).

The sum of the interior angles of a polygon can be calculated using the formula ( (n - 2) \times 180^\circ ), where ( n ) is the number of sides. For a 34-sided polygon, the sum of the interior angles is ( (34 - 2) \times 180^\circ = 32 \times 180^\circ = 5760^\circ ).
